Transaction 51b1624a6528ab1c63e873c3ca6737473ca835deb5a9413896109087626d176f
1 Input
2 Outputs
- 51b1624a6528ab1c63e873c3ca6737473ca835deb5a9413896109087626d176f:0
- 51b1624a6528ab1c63e873c3ca6737473ca835deb5a9413896109087626d176f:1
value 10000000
address 33B1b6EksUjUhJpSsRQ4MLadxFuimJ9C4X
value 24705473
address 12S76F4SWCQWFZ9uiqttovYj6aMxerqovp